Chaîne de requête

Définition - Que signifie la chaîne de requête?

Une chaîne de requête est la partie d'une URL où les données sont transmises à une application Web et / ou à une base de données principale. La raison pour laquelle nous avons besoin de chaînes de requête est que le protocole HTTP est sans état par conception. Pour qu'un site Web soit autre chose qu'une brochure, vous devez maintenir l'état (stocker les données). Il existe plusieurs façons de procéder: Sur la plupart des serveurs Web, vous pouvez utiliser quelque chose comme l'état de session côté serveur. Sur le client, vous pouvez stocker via des cookies. Ou dans l'URL, vous pouvez stocker des données via une chaîne de requête.

Definir Tech explique la chaîne de requête

Sur le World Wide Web, toutes les URL peuvent être décomposées en protocole, l'emplacement du fichier (ou du programme) et la chaîne de requête. Le protocole que vous voyez dans un navigateur est presque toujours HTTP; l'emplacement est la forme typique du nom d'hôte et du nom de fichier (par exemple, www.techopedia.com/somefile.html), et la chaîne de requête est celle qui suit le signe de point d'interrogation ("?").

Par exemple, dans l'URL ci-dessous, la zone en gras est la chaîne de requête qui a été générée lorsque le terme «base de données» a été recherché sur le site Web de Definir Tech.

//www.techopedia.com/search.aspx?q = base de données§ion = tout